Cave art, generally, the numerous paintings and engravings found in caves and shelters dating back to the ice age (upper paleolithic), roughly between 40,000 and 14,000 years ago. In the dark recesses of hundreds of caves around the world, our prehistoric ancestors painted lush panoramas of ancient animals — herds of herbivores racing across the caves’ walls. Prehistoric art illustrates early human creativity through small portable objects, cave paintings, and early sculpture and architecture. Who created cave art, and what was its initial purpose?
